Description

Fusing classic Fender design with player-centric features and exciting new finishes, the Player Plus Nashville Telecaster delivers superb playability and unmistakable style. Powered by a set of Player Plus Noiseless pickups, the Player Plus Nashville Tele delivers warm, sweet Tele twang – as well as Strat in-between tones – without hum. A push-pull switch on the tone control engages the neck pickup in switch positions 1 & 2 for two additional tones. The silky satin Modern “C” Player Plus Tele® neck fits your hand like a glove, with smooth rolled edges for supreme comfort. The 12” radius fingerboard and 22 medium jumbo frets facilitate fluid leads and choke free bends. A modern 6-saddle Tele bridge with block steel saddles adds a touch of brightness while providing precise intonation and the locking tuners provide rock-solid tuning and make string changes quick and easy. I own 30 guitars that range in price from $800 to $8000. I’m not going tell you it plays as nice as a very high end PRs or MusicMan guitar but I will tell you, it plays and sounds really really good. I think the skimp is on hardware and to minor degree craftsmanship/ detail (but not too bad at all). It does all the stuff right but doesn’t have that solid feel in the tuners or volume/tone knobs for example. All easily upgraded. It plays and feels great too. I expected that I would try it and return it but noooo I’m keeping it. By the way I do have an American Tele that I’ve had for at least 20 years and it’s great. This one keeps up with it very nicely and has many more sonic options. This is a solid guitar. Should have come with a hard shell case but here again, also a price point thing. The Mex Tele’s are apparently MUCH nicer than they once were. Buy it, upgrade it and have fun! ... show more
